ORLANDO — The big news coming out of Disney’s D23 Destination D mega conference included the names and the first-ever look inside the two signature attractions set for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ge when it opens at Disneyland Resort next summer and at Walt Disney World Resort in fall 2019.

The D23 Expo and its counterpart, D23 Destination D – the ‘23’ is for 1923, the year Walt Disney founded his iconic company – are major events on the calendar for all Disney fans. That includes anyone who sells Disney, especially for travel, as there are always plenty of updates coming out of the event.

Taking place this past weekend, the 2018 D23’s Destination D: Celebrating Mickey Mouse featured park updates from Disney Parks, Experiences and Consumer Products Chairman Bob Chapek.

“We are currently in the midst of one of the most extraordinary periods of expansion in our history,” says Chapek. “We are always pushing the boundaries of what’s possible as we deliver world-class experiences and attractions, new hotels and entertainment, itineraries and destinations for our guests.”

Here’s a full look at all the announcements…

STAR WARS: GALAXY’S EDGE
When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ge opens at Disneyland Resort next summer and at Walt Disney World Resort in fall 2019, guests can take the controls in one of three unique and critical roles aboard Millennium Falcon: Smugglers Run. Meanwhile on Star Wars: Rise of the Resistance, guests can join an epic battle between the First Order and the Resistance – including a face-off with Kylo Ren.

The two new experiences will be paired with the land’s interactive components and optional integration with the Play Disney Parks app.

Chapek also provided a sneak peek at the Star Wars resort coming to Walt Disney World Resort. The multi-day, fully immersive adventure will take guests aboard a luxury starship with all the features expected of a first-class hotel, including dining, recreation, and accommodations, “all authentic to the Star Wars universe”.

MICKEY MOUSE
The mouse that started it all, Mickey Mouse, turns 90 this year. Chapek says Disney Imagineers have been hard at work creating Mickey & Minnie’s Runaway Railway, using breakthrough technology to transform a 2D cartoon into a real-world experience. The first-ever ride-through attraction themed to Mickey Mouse – set to open in fall 2019 – will feature a new original story and theme song.

On Jan. 18, 2019 ‘Mickey’s Mix Magic’ will light up the night at Disneyland Park with all-new music, projections and lasers that set the scene for an epic dance party that takes over almost the entire park. The party will get even bigger when the fan-favorite Mickey’s Soundsational Parade returns to the resort Jan. 25, featuring an all-new float with Mickey himself, who will lead the celebration down Main Street, U.S.A.

And at Walt Disney World, from Jan. 18 to Sept. 30 Mickey & Minnie’s Surprise Celebration at Magic Kingdom will feature new food, merchandise and entertainment.

A new cinematic nighttime experience, ‘Wonderful World of Animation’, is coming to Disney’s Hollywood Studios on May 1 as part of the 30th Anniversary of Disney’s Hollywood Studios. The show take guests on a journey through more than 90 years of Disney animation, all beginning with Mickey.

EPCOT
A multi-year transformation of Epcot, designed to honour the park’s original vision while making it “more timeless, more relevant, more family and more Disney”, is currently underway.

Chapek revealed that the Ratatouille experience coming to the France pavilion will be called Remy’s Ratatouille Adventure. There’s also a new ‘Beauty and the Beast’ sing-along. And Canadians will be glad to hear this news: an update to the O Canada! 360-degree show.

NEW RESORTS
Chapek also revealed the name of Disney’s newest resort: Reflections. The deluxe, nature-inspired resort coming to Orlando will feature more than 900 hotel rooms and proposed Disney Vacation Club villas when it opens in 2020.

Chapek also offered a look at Disney’s Riviera Resort, projected to open in fall 2019, as the 15th Disney Vacation Club property.
